51 if(
m_debug )
std::cout <<
"RBCLogicUnit> Problem initialising LogicTool \n";
void run(const RBCInput &, std::bitset< 2 > &)
void setBoardSpecs(const RBCBoardSpecs::RBCBoardConfig &)
virtual std::bitset< 6 > * getlayersignal(int)=0
RBCLogicUnit()
Standard constructor.
virtual void setBoardSpecs(const RBCBoardSpecs::RBCBoardConfig &)=0
~RBCLogicUnit() override
Destructor.
void setlogic(const char *)
virtual void process(const RBCInput &, std::bitset< 2 > &)=0
std::bitset< 6 > * m_layersignal[2]
LogicTool< RBCLogic > * m_logtool